Creating your own Vegan Spinach Artichoke Dip is an odyssey that begins with simplicity and ends with satisfaction. Here’s a culinary compass to guide you:
Ingredients:
- 1 cup of cooked spinach (squeezed and drained)
- 1 cup of artichoke hearts (chopped)
- 1 cup of vegan cream cheese
- ½ cup of vegan mayonnaise
- ½ cup of nutritional yeast
- 2 cloves of garlic (minced)
- 1 teaspoon of l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
Method:
- In a mixing bowl, combine the vegan cream cheese, vegan mayonnaise, and nutritional yeast until smooth and creamy.
- Fold in the cooked spinach, chopped artichoke hearts, minced garlic, and lemon juice.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Transfer the mixture to a baking dish and bake at 375°F (190°C) for about 20 minutes, until the dip is hot and bubbly.
- Serve with your choice of crackers, bread, or fresh veggies.
